[tps_footer]’After My Garden Grows’ is about girl child marriages in India and tells the story of Monika, a rural Indian teenager growing food to feed her family and the seeds of her own independence in a tiny rooftop garden. Recently, a screening was held by Aamir Khan in Lightbox for the documentary, where supporting him was actress Kangana Ranaut apart from his personal as well as film family.
